What can you catch with a Panther Martin?

Panther Martin Holographic Red Hook spinners work especially well for brook trout, cutthroats, Arctic char and Dolly Varden. For stream and river fishing in strong flows, be sure to quarter the current in an upstream direction with each cast. Begin your retrieve as the current swings the spinner into the strike zone.

Can you catch bass with a Panther Martin?

Catching Largemouth Bass. When largemouths are in an aggressive mood, work a Panther Martin spinner quickly just below the surface to draw vicious hits. Adding twitches to the retrieve can trigger reaction strikes.

Should you use a snap swivel with a lure?

Although snap swivels can save you time, they’re too big and bulky and will most likely scare off the fish either by their unnatural look, or just their presence in the water. Sure, you might catch a few young, naive, aggressive with it, but if you want to maximize your chances of catching fish, it’s not a good idea.

Can you use Panther Martin in saltwater?

They match up well with largemouth and smallmouth bass, pike and pickerel in freshwater. In saltwater, use them to target gamefish species such as redfish, snook, sea trout, and striped bass. Plenty of flash and a long profile assure interest frmo trophy fish.

How fast should you reel in a spinner?

How fast do you reel a spinnerbait? Option 1: Most of the time the best retrieval speed is going just fast enough to make blades spin. If you fish your spinnerbait too fast it will roll on its side. If you see this you have to slow down your retrieval speed.

Can trout see you?

Trout have excellent vision within the center of the cone and that vision extends about 320 degrees around him except for the blind spot in back. 4. A trout can judge distance only straight ahead and immediately upward within the range of both eyes, and that is why they will face the fly directly. 5.
